L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Unplug the cooktop and allow it to cool. Remove surface debris with a soft cloth and mild detergent; avoid abrasive pads. Wipe ceramic glass top with a non-abrasive cleaner and a microfiber cloth. Clean control knobs and stainless trim with a pH-neutral cleaner, then rinse and dry. Inspect vents and remove grease buildup to reduce fire risk. Check the package for visible damage before accepting to ensure product integrity.#@@#Maintenance Guide#@#Inspect the cooktop daily for spills and cool it before cleaning. Remove loose debris with a soft brush, then wipe the ceramic glass top with a nonabrasive cloth and pH-neutral detergent as per label instructions. Gently scrub control knobs and ensure manual controls operate fully. Check electrical connections and tighten terminal screws while power is off. Calibrate surface temperature with a contact thermometer monthly.
